WebSep 24, 2024 · In most cases when learning how to build a shed foundation, the shed doesn’t have to rest on deep footings. A pair of trenches filled with gravel and topped with treated 6x6s is adequate in areas with well-drained soil. Level and square the 6x6s and you’re ready to build and attach the joist system.
